U.S. Senate Majority Leader Harry Reid said on Wednesday he planned to defy a threatened White House veto and try to win passage of a bill to curb rising home foreclosures by changing bankruptcy law.

“I have no expectation of reaching any agreement with the White House,” said Reid a day after the administration warned the bill would need changes to get President George W. Bush’s signature.

“I have tried for seven years” to reach agreements with Bush on a variety of issues, but have repeatedly failed, said Reid, a Nevada Democrat, at a news conference.

“So we are going to do what we think is best for the country,” Reid said. “If we get 67 votes (in the 100-member Senate to override a possible Bush veto), that’s great.”

The Senate could turn to the housing bill in the next few days, but it must first overcome a possible Republican procedural hurdle that would take 60 votes to clear.

“I think we are going to get more than 60 votes,” said Reid, whose fellow Democrats control the Senate, 51-49.
